Output 21a15dcf818fc32314b14904d2e33de97629bd74f0d5fc5b04574fcf04b52883:1

value
6952973831088
script pubkey
OP_0 OP_PUSHBYTES_20 2d39da965c87a41ca05c3c94f6cbe8ab67a986ac
address
tb1q95ua49jus7jpegzu8j20djlg4dn6np4v7e2w7g
transaction
21a15dcf818fc32314b14904d2e33de97629bd74f0d5fc5b04574fcf04b52883
confirmations
157256
spent
true